If you are paying rent on time for both apartments, there will be no impact on your credit report or credit score. Landlords use credit bureaus to check the credit of potential renters, however, they very rarely report abuse until the renter is many months behind. Having two rental units should not impact your credit score unless you have missed a number of rent payments.
Due to concerns about identity, equal opportunity and character, almost all landlords in Maryland do credit checks on potential renters. Also, most landlords will charge you for obtaining the credit check, even if they don't rent you the apartment. One may be able to avoid credit checks by renting near Colleges and Universities as there is an understanding that most college and university students don't have useful credit records.
